About the Opportunity

As an Associate Consultant, you will support the delivery of high-quality, insight-led strategy projects for global biopharma clients, developing your skills across research, analysis, and strategic communication under the guidance of senior colleagues.

You will contribute to teams working on critical questions such as:

  • How should a novel oncology asset be positioned for optimal reimbursement?
  • What evidence is required to support value in rare diseases?
  • How can pricing strategy be optimised across global markets?
  • What are the payer risks and how can they be mitigated early?

Your time will be broadly split across:

  • ~85% project delivery
  • ~15% capability building, internal initiatives, and professional development

You'll be part of a fast-growing, PE-backed organisation, where you will gain hands-on exposure to client work, start to build your expertise in value, pricing, and access strategy, and develop your career within a supportive and expert team.

Key Responsibilities

Strategic Project Delivery

  • Support delivery of value, pricing, and access strategy projects across the product life cycle, under the direction of senior team members
  • Conduct literature searches and critically review, extract, and summarise relevant evidence on pricing, reimbursement, and payer decision-making
  • Help translate research and evidence into clear insights, with guidance from senior colleagues
  • Support landscape assessments, analogue research, and policy analysis to inform client strategy
  • Build up internal knowledge of pricing and reimbursement systems and market access policy trends worldwide
  • Contribute to the preparation of client deliverables, reports, and presentations
  • Support logistical and planning tasks, including helping to coordinate stakeholder interviews and arrange meetings with external stakeholders
  • Help manage own tasks and timelines to support delivery against client expectations
  • Collaborate effectively with project teams across multiple workstreams

Client Engagement

  • Support day-to-day communication with clients, as directed by senior team members
  • Begin to build working relationships with client stakeholders
  • Contribute to the delivery of high-quality, insight-driven outputs
  • Participate in client meetings, workshops, and presentations

Business Development Support

  • Support development of project proposals and pitch materials
  • Contribute to internal knowledge sharing initiatives

Cross-Functional Collaboration

  • Work closely with colleagues across Commercial, Medical, and Competitive Strategy practices
  • Contribute to integrated, cross-functional client solutions
  • Collaborate with senior team members to support strategic recommendations

Professional Development

  • Actively engage in training and professional development opportunities
  • Contribute to team culture, collaboration, and effective communication

Travel

Associate Consultants may be required to travel occasionally to support project delivery and client relationships.

Essential Skills and Experience

  • Some experience or exposure to market access, pricing, policy, or healthcare, gained through academic study, an internship, or previous employment (desirable)
  • Experience researching complex information and summarising findings into slides or reports, whether through academic study or work experience (essential)
  • Basic understanding of, or strong interest in learning about:
    • Drug development and commercialisation
    • Global pricing and reimbursement systems
    • HTA and payer decision-making
    • Exposure to or interest in oncology, rare diseases, or specialty therapeutics (desirable)
  • Strong analytical and research skills with an ability to read, understand, and summarise complex information
  • Good written and verbal communication skills
  • Strong organisational skills, attention to detail, and ability to manage timelines and meet deadlines, with support from senior colleagues
  • Ability to multi-task and collaborate effectively in fast-paced, team-oriented environments
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office software (Word, Excel, PowerPoint)
  • Education: BA/BS required; postgraduate qualification in a health-related field (e.g. health policy, health economics, biostatistics, epidemiology) or life sciences is a plus, but not required

About Prescient Healthcare Group

Prescient® is a pharma services firm specialising in dynamic decision support and product and portfolio strategy. We partner with our clients to turn science into value by helping them understand the potential of their molecules, shaping their strategic plans, and allowing their decision-making to be the biggest differentiating factor in the success of their products. When companies partner with Prescient, the molecules in their hands have a greater potential for success than the same science in the hands of their competitors.

Founded in 2007, Prescient is a global firm with a footprint in 10 cities across three continents. Our team of nearly 475 experts partners with 27 of the top 30 biopharmaceutical companies, the fastest-growing mid-caps, and cutting-edge emerging biotechs, including some of the biggest and most innovative brands. More than 70% of our employees hold advanced life science degrees, and our teams deliver an impressive depth of therapeutic, clinical, and commercial expertise.

With the addition of Dolon, Prescient continues to expand its capabilities in value, pricing, and access, strengthening our ability to support clients in bringing innovative therapies to patients worldwide.

Prescient has been a portfolio company of Bridgepoint Development Capital since 2021 and Baird Capital since 2017. For more information, please visit www.prescienthg.com.
